The battery charger for an mp3 player contains a step-down transformer with a turns ratio of 1:24, so that the voltage of 120 v
miskamm [114]
Considering that we are talking about a stepdown transformer, and a turn ration of 1:24

Then

Vsecondary coil = 120 V / 24 = 5V

(But lets remember that the power must be conserved in the transformer, so the voltage is 24 times less, but the current is 24 times higher)

It provides 5 volts to operate the player or charge the batteries

A dandelion seed floats to the ground in a mild wind with a resultant velocity of 26.0 cm/s. If the horizontal component velocit
stira [4]

Answer:

24 cm/s

Explanation:

Applying

Pythagoras theorem,

a² = b²+c²............. Equation 1

Where a = resultant, b = vertical component, c = horizontal component

From the question,

Given: a = 26 cm/s, c = 10 cm/s

Substitute these values into equation 1

26² = b²+10²

676 = b²+100

b² = 676-100

b² = 576

b = √576

b = 24 cm/s
